Transaction 6b88bee104f769c9dd433892af4ff1cb11b4073b0731531e27338b16a5314a67
1 Input
1 Output
-
6b88bee104f769c9dd433892af4ff1cb11b4073b0731531e27338b16a5314a67:0
- value
- 40543628
- script pubkey
- OP_0 OP_PUSHBYTES_20 eddddc5ad8cba0890fe6d20c3151d61c92e660fb
- address
- bc1qahwackkcewsgjrlx6gxrz5wkrjfwvc8mzc2urk